Reopening & Readjustments
As Dr. Noonan has reported to us all, we will have some readjustments soon! Some of our students will be coming to school for a face to face experience, while the rest of the children will continue online. The teachers and staff have been doing wonderful work with everyone as we have started 100% virtual, but multiple metrics are telling us it is time to at least invite children into the building to experience a more 'typical' preschool experience, albeit with smaller groups and safe protocols for health! At this time, given the size of our building and classrooms, in order to maintain the social distancing requirement, we are able to invite only certain groups of children. We appreciate your choices and understanding, especially for those that require and want something different.
Materials Distribution this Week!
Material packets for the next 1-2 weeks will be available during the day, next to the front door, 7:30-4 PM, Tuesday through Thursday. Please remember to pick these up so that your child will be prepared for their learning activities! Let Marie know if you need special accommodations or alternatives for pickup.

Class Assignment Changes
While I am hoping to keep class changes to a minimum, I have no choice but to make some adjustments given two instructional models for some of our children. Our JTP teaching teams will teach either in person OR virtual, not both (except for some coaching, which would be virtual). More information will be coming soon!

Be a Great Citizen!
When talking to families this week, I was reminded that keeping this virus at bay is a community effort requiring good citizenship. Please consider:
- Flu shots for all family members
- Strict mask wearing & handwashing
- Limiting social interactions with others
